asked the Secretary of State for Defence, pursuant to his answer of 2 April 1987, if he will publish in the Official Report the locations of the 40 observation points on Gwynedd at which rainfall measurements are taken.

A list of the meteorological observing stations in Gwynedd, showing the location name and national grid reference of each, is as follows:
